Finding Reliable Tenants in London: A Landlord's Guide

Securing the ideal tenant in London can be an test for any landlord. The process involves considerably than simply posting the listing. Careful vetting is absolutely critical to safeguard property's investment and avoid potential issues. Start by running extensive background checks including credit history and past leasing references. Utilize tenant referencing services which can provide important insights. In conclusion, always rely on your instinct – if something doesn't feel right, don’t ignore it.

London Rental Market Trends: What Tenants and Lettings Providers Need to Know

The capital's rental market continues to undergo shifts, presenting both difficulties and possibilities for renters and letting agents. Over the past few months, leasing rises have lessened, although common costs remain substantial across many boroughs. In particular, more compact apartments are showing lower demand compared to larger residences. Furthermore, mortgage rates and the household budget are influencing occupier financial capacity, maybe leading to a reduction in lease fees. Landlords are advised to thoroughly assess these trends when setting rental rents and managing their holdings.

How to Find Renters Quickly: Your London Room Leasing Checklist

Securing quality tenants quickly in London's competitive landscape requires a efficient approach. First, ensure your listing is attractive with professional photos and a thorough description showcasing the room's best features. Then, extensively distribute it across major platforms like Rightmove, Zoopla, and OpenRent. Consider including a digital viewing to connect with potential applicants who are unable to view in person. Finally, move swiftly with credit reports and interact clearly with promising candidates to secure the right match for your London room.
